First, let's talk about the order of operations, also known as the precedence of operators. This is the set of rules that tells us which operations to perform first in a mathematical expression. Without these rules, we might end up with different answers depending on the order in which we solve the equation. The acronym PEMDAS, as I mentioned earlier, is a handy way to remember the order:

  • Parentheses: Solve anything inside parentheses first.
  • Exponents: Deal with exponents (powers and roots) next.
  • Multiplication and Division: Perform these operations from left to right.
  • Addition and Subtraction: Finally, handle addition and subtraction from left to right.

In our expression, -7×3-15-24÷2×5-7, there are no parentheses or exponents. So, we'll start with multiplication and division. Step-by-Step Solution: Breaking Down the Math

Multiplication: -7 × 3

First up, we have the multiplication operation: -7 × 3. When you multiply a negative number by a positive number, the result is negative. So, -7 multiplied by 3 equals -21. We replace “-7 × 3” with “-21”, and rewrite the entire expression.

So the expression now becomes: -21 - 15 - 24 ÷ 2 × 5 - 7

Division: 24 ÷ 2

Next, we tackle the division: 24 ÷ 2. Twenty-four divided by 2 equals 12. We replace “24 ÷ 2” with “12” in our updated expression.

Now, the expression is: -21 - 15 - 12 × 5 - 7

Multiplication: 12 × 5

Next, we handle the second multiplication: 12 × 5. Twelve multiplied by 5 equals 60. We replace “12 × 5” with “60”.

Our expression simplifies to: -21 - 15 - 60 - 7

Addition and Subtraction: -21 - 15 - 60 - 7

Finally, we perform the addition and subtraction, working from left to right. This is where it’s super important to keep track of the signs (positive or negative) of each number.

  • -21 - 15 = -36
  • -36 - 60 = -96
  • -96 - 7 = -103

So, the solution to the expression is -103!

Further Practice Problems

Ready for more? Here are a few similar problems for you to practice on. Try solving these using the steps we've covered. The more you practice, the easier it will become. Remember to always follow the order of operations!

  1. -5 × 4 + 10 - 18 ÷ 3 × 2 + 8
  2. 20 ÷ 2 - 3 × 5 + 12 - 4
  3. -3 × (6 - 2) + 15 ÷ 5 - 7

These problems are designed to reinforce your understanding of PEMDAS and to help you become more confident in solving mathematical expressions. Work through these exercises at your own pace, and don't be afraid to double-check your work.

Answers to Practice Problems

Here are the answers to the practice problems. Check your work to see how well you did!

  1. -26
  2. -3
  3. -14
